AC Milan: Between injuries and Leao's return, here's what's leaked for the match against Fiorentina.
AC Milan are preparing to face Fiorentina with some difficulty, due to a series of injuries that have affected some of their key players while on international duty. In particular, Rabiot and Pulisic returned from their squad with physical problems, which will force them to miss the next Serie A match.
Rabiot and Pulisic are of concern, while Saelemaekers is still being evaluated.
Adrien Rabiot He suffered a calf contusion during a training session with the French national team, an injury that will prevent him from playing against Fiorentina. The French midfielder underwent an MRI scan, which revealed a lesion to the soleus muscle in his left calf. His condition will be reevaluated in about ten days, but he is expected to be out for about a month. Christian Pulisic, who had shown good promise after a positive start to the season, will be out for a while. The American striker suffered a problem with his right thigh biceps femoris during international duty. His condition will be reevaluated today, with Allegri who hopes to have it back as soon as possible.
Good news is coming on the front instead Alexis SaelemaekerThe Belgian suffered a minor injury to his right hamstring during the match between Belgium and North Macedonia. Despite the injury, Saelemaekers has already begun individual training on the pitch, and his condition is improving. If there are no complications, the former Roma player could be available for the match against Fiorentina.
Leao returns to the starting lineup
While Milan finds itself without some of its starters, there is some good news on the way: Rafael Leao He's ready to return to the pitch. The Portuguese, who had been suffering from a muscle injury, was called up to his national team but played only 29 minutes in the match against Ireland. After his early return to Milanello, Leao worked intensively during the week, and his physical condition is clearly improving. The Rossoneri number 10, after brief appearances against Napoli and Juventus, is preparing for his first league start, aiming to score his first Serie A goal of the season.
